#9ee488 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ee488 is composed of 62% red, 89.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 105.7 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 71.4%. #9ee488 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3dc911.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#9ee488 color description : Very soft lime green.
#9ee488 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ee488 has RGB values of R:158, G:228,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10413192.

Shades and Tints of #9ee488
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ee488
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b7b5 is the less saturated color, while #92fa72 is the most saturated one.
